George Clooney and Brad Pitt fall out over film role?

Insiders claim the actors are both vying for lead in remake of My Fair Lady

Brad Pitt and George Clooney
Brad Pitt and George Clooney have been close friends for years

George Clooney and Brad Pitt are said to be at loggerheads over a forthcoming movie.

The actors, who have been friends for years, apparently can’t come to an agreement over who should play Henry Higgins in movie remake of My Fair Lady. And the row has got so bad that the pair are not even talking.

'We both badly want a particular role and neither is backing down,’ George, 47, is said to have told pals, Metro reports.

‘It's sort of become an intense competition between us now and it just keeps escalating.'

It's said that Brad, 44, has been fixated with the story since he was a child and is determined to win the part.

And he wants partner Angelina Jolie, 33, to star alongside him as Eliza Doolittle.

My Fair Lady was originally released in 1964.
